The AirTAC GFR30008LF1WTK AirTAC Filter Regulator NPT1/4 is a genuine G-series filter regulator: water separation, 5 µm particulate filtration and balanced-type pressure regulation combined in a single body. It has PT1/4" ports, a differential-pressure drain and regulates 0.15 - 0.9 MPa (20 - 130 psi). It does not lubricate — add a GL lubricator, or order the GFC two-unit set, if downstream equipment needs oil.
The AirTAC GFR30008LF1WTK is a GFR300-series filter regulator: it removes water and particulate from compressed air and regulates downstream pressure in one compact body. This configuration is built for a 1/4 in NPT port, is the low-pressure regulator type, carries the 5 um filter element (code W), and drains condensate by differential pressure. It comes with the embedded square pressure gauge on the MPa scale, a reverse/check valve fitted on the regulator, and a mounting bracket. The polycarbonate bowl and body are rated for a maximum inlet pressure of 1.0 MPa (145 psi), and the operating temperature range is -5 to 70 C (non-freezing).

The GFR family spans sizes 200, 300, 400 and 600 with ports from 1/8 to 1 in, configurable by drain type (differential-pressure, automatic or manual), filter grade (40 um standard, 5 um optional), gauge style and scale, thread (PT standard, with G and NPT as order options), reverse/check valve and bracket. The regulating band is set by the drain type: automatic and differential-pressure drains regulate 0.15 - 0.9 MPa, a manual drain regulates 0.05 - 0.9 MPa. The low-pressure type adjusts over a lower band than standard; we confirm the exact figures from the factory datasheet. Air must not freeze in the unit. | GFR300 | G-series filter regulator, 300 body — sets the port range. |
|---|---|
| 08 | Port size PT1/4". This body offers 08 = PT1/4", 10 = PT3/8", 15 = PT1/2". |
| (blank) | Drain: Differential-pressure drain — this also sets the regulating band (0.15 - 0.9 MPa (20 - 130 psi)). |
| L | Low-pressure type. Blank is standard, L is the low-pressure type. |
| (blank) | Mounting bracket included. |
| (blank) | Pressure gauge fitted (blank). |
| F | Gauge shape: Square. C is round, F is square. |
| 1 | Gauge scale: MPa. 1 is MPa, 2 is psi, 3 is bar. |
| W | Filtering grade 5 µm. Only 40 µm (blank) and 5 µm (W) exist. |
| T | NPT thread. PT is the default; G is BSPP and T is NPT. |
| K | Reverse-flow (reflux) valve fitted. |
Field order is size, port, drain, type, bracket, gauge, shape, scale, grade, thread, reflux — a blank position takes the default. Example: GFR300-08 is a 300 body, PT1/4", differential drain, standard type, bracket included, gauge fitted, 40 µm, PT thread, no reflux valve.
A larger body carries a larger port and holds set pressure better as flow rises. AirTAC publishes flow only as curves, so size the body from your peak demand with headroom. The GFR600 uses an aluminium-alloy bowl; the 200, 300 and 400 bodies use PC.

Filtering and regulating the air that actuates pneumatic clamps on an assembly fixture, where the low-pressure regulator type supplies a reduced pressure to the clamp cylinders and the 5 um element protects the directional-valve seals.
Supplying clean, regulated air to the cylinders that raise gates and stopers along a packaging conveyor, with the fitted reverse/check valve holding the downstream side if the main supply dips.
Conditioning shop air into a filtered, low-pressure supply for instrument and actuator testing on a lab bench, with the embedded MPa gauge giving a direct local readout of the set pressure.
Size and port are the first choice: GFR300 takes a 1/4 in port, and the 200/300/400/600 steps move up in port size and flow capacity, so match the step to the air your circuit actually uses. From there the decodable options are: low-pressure regulator type (this unit) versus standard; 5 um filtration (this unit, code W) versus the 40 um standard; differential-pressure drain (this unit) versus automatic or manual; square MPa gauge (this unit, code F1) with psi or bar scales available; NPT thread (this unit, code T) against PT standard or G; reverse/check valve fitted (code K); and bracket included. The PC bowl must not be cleaned with solvents — wipe it with a dry cloth. The reflux valve permits reverse flow through the unit. A filter regulator adds no oil to the line.
